广州红匣子新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> APP开发 > Python开发微信小程序:从入门到高级应用

陈经理

15年全栈工程师

广州红匣子技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

Python开发微信小程序:从入门到高级应用

时间:2025-06-12 05:43:00来源:红匣子科技阅读:250612
Python在微信小程序开发中的重要性随着移动互联网的快速发展,微信小程序已成为企业展示和运营的重要平台。而Python作为一种功能强大的编程语言,正在以其独特的优势被广泛应用于小程序开发中。无论是数据处理、后端开发,还是前后端分离,Python都能为小程序的高效运行提供强有力的支持。Python的

Python在微信小程序开发中的重要性

随着移动互联网的快速发展,微信小程序已成为企业展示和运营的重要平台。而Python作为一种功能强大的编程语言,正在以其独特的优势被广泛应用于小程序开发中。无论是数据处理、后端开发,还是前后端分离,Python都能为小程序的高效运行提供强有力的支持。

Python的语法简洁易学,适合快速上手。对于有一定编程基础的开发者来说,Python的代码结构清晰,注释功能完善,能够显著缩短学习成本。Python的生态系统非常丰富,拥有NumPy、Pandas、Matplotlib等强大库,能够满足小程序的数据分析、可视化展示等需求。

在微信小程序的开发中,Python可以与微信提供的“微信开放平台”进行深度集成。通过调用微信提供的API,开发者可以轻松实现消息通知、支付处理、图片上传等功能。例如,使用PPayAPI可以实现微信支付,使用WAPI可以调用微信的文件共享功能。

Python的后端开发能力也是小程序开发的重要优势。通过编写API接口,开发者可以将小程序的功能扩展到其他平台或应用,实现数据双向流转。这种“一project多用”的开发模式,不仅提升了开发效率,还为小程序的长期运营提供了保障。

Python作为微信小程序开发的核心工具,凭借其强大的功能和丰富的生态系统,成为小程序开发者的首选语言。掌握Python,将为开发者打开小程序开发的新篇章。

从Python到微信小程序:开发案例解析

开发一个微信小程序,从基础到进阶,需要经历哪些步骤?如何从零开始编写第一个小程序?以下将通过一个实际案例,展示从需求分析、功能设计、代码实现到部署上线的全过程。

第一步:需求分析与功能设计

在开发之前,需求分析是非常关键的一步。我们需要明确小程序的目标用户是谁,小程序将为用户提供哪些功能。例如,假设我们要开发一个线上图书小程序,需求分析可能包括:用户可以浏览图书、购买图书、查看订单等。

在功能设计阶段,我们需要将这些需求转化为具体的代码实现。例如,购买功能需要处理用户登录、订单支付、库存管理等逻辑。这类功能的实现,离不开Python的强大处理能力。

第二步:代码实现与调试优化

编写代码是小程序开发的核心环节。以图书小程序为例,我们需要设计图书信息展示界面、用户注册登录系统、购物车管理等模块。

在代码实现中,调试和优化是不可忽视的环节。通过编写测试用例,我们可以验证每个功能是否正常运行。如果发现bug,及时进行修复,确保小程序的稳定性和用户体验。

第三步:部署与上线

当小程序的功能开发完成,下一步就是将其部署到微信的开放平台。通过微信提供的API,我们可以将Python代码转换为小程序的运行环境。

部署过程中,需要注意服务器的配置和优化。通过调整服务器资源,可以提升小程序的运行速度和流畅度。定期监控小程序的运行状态,发现问题及时进行调整,确保小程序能够持续为用户提供服务。

案例总结:从代码到实践

通过上述案例,我们可以看到,Python在小程序开发中的重要性。从需求分析到代码实现,再到部署优化,每一步都需要Python的支持。这种开发模式不仅提升了开发效率,还为小程序的持续优化提供了便利。

对于想学习Python开发微信小程序的读者来说,关键是要有耐心和毅力。通过不断学习和实践,掌握Python的精髓,相信您一定能够开发出一个功能完善、用户体验良好的微信小程序。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
广州APP定制开发公司

上一篇:Python助力微信小程序开发!打造高效应用

下一篇:Python开发的软件有哪些?

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询